Heathlands is in Stourport-On-Severn and in Wyre Forest district. DY13 9NS is located in the Mitton electoral ward, within the English Parliamentary constituency of Wyre Forest. This postcode has been in use since 1993-01-01.

Is Heathlands Street dangerous?

Over the last 12 months, the overall crime rate around Heathlands was 19.5 per 1,000 residents, which is 85.1% lower than the Areley Kings & Riverside average. The most reported crime type was Violence and sexual offences.

Heathlands has the 6th lowest crime rate of 68 local areas in Areley Kings & Riverside and the 40th lowest crime rate of 334 local areas in Wyre Forest .

Violent and sexual offences accounted for around 7.8 crimes per 1,000 residents and have been rising year on year. Over the last decade, overall crime has fallen by about -38.2%.

Employment

DY13 9NS area has a low unemployment rate. According to Census 2021, 1% residents of this area were unemployed, while the average in the UK was 4.83%. A low level of unemployment in an area indicates a strong job market, where most people who are seeking work can find employment. This generally reflects a healthy economy in the area.

The percentage of retired residents living in DY13 9NS area is much higher than the country's average. According to Census 2011, 31% residents of this area were retired, while the average in the UK was 14%.
